I have not done one yet. I am anxious to give it a try. The device add function offers to add a serial device. Then a nice looking menu comes up with settings for all of the basics, baud, #bits, #stop bits, etc. Looks very clean.

Then next screen is the ability to import rs-232 codes from a spreadsheet or other text output, which seems like a great function and could be a great time saver. Import is either in ASCII or Hex.

I am very happy with the NevoConnect so far, just haven't tried RS-232 yet. Other great thing with the NevoConnect is any of the 6 plugs in the back can be used for addressable IR, serial, video sync or voltage sensing. Just use a different cable device. UEI has 4 different cable devices for each of these functions.
